Who’s in it?
Of course, the time-lord herself, Jodie Whittaker, is along for the ride in her swansong, as well as companions Yaz (Mandip Gill) and Dan (John Bishop). But they were obvious! The teaser revealed a few other surprises for the centenary special.
Vinder
Fan favourite from Doctor Who: Flux (or series 13), Inston-Vee Vinder (Jacob Anderson) has been confirmed to return for the feature-length special.
It’s not known in what capacity, or if his “life-partner” Bel (Thaddea Graham) or Karvanista (Craige Els), will be returning too. Nevertheless, fans are excited to see him on our screens again!
Kate Stewart
Kate Stewart, daughter of classic series companion Brigadier Lethbridge-Stewart, will be making an appearance too. After Flux revealed she’d been on the run for four years, fans are hoping the UNIT officer’s appearance in the special will be longer than last time.
Tegan and Ace
‘I haven’t heard from the Doctor in nearly four decades’
‘Just cause it’s only three decades for me.’
That’s right, Tegan, companion to the fourth and fifth Doctor and Ace, companion to the seventh, are making a long-awaited return! The first classic companions to return to Doctor Who since Sarah Jane in 2006, fans are beyond themselves at what they’ll be up to in the special.
With Russel T. Davies making Tegan and Nyssa – another companion to the fourth and fifth Doctor – a couple in ‘Farewell, Sarah Jane‘, will Nyssa be appearing too?
Who Are They Fighting?
Now that we’ve covered all of the Doctor’s friends set to return, who is the big bad? Well, there’s more than one.
Daleks
Would it be a thirteen special without them? After appearing in all three of Whittaker’s New Year’s Day specials, it’s only right that the Daleks are here for her last one.
Eagle-eyed fans have noticed that they look different to the last time we saw them (eye-stalk in particular), but will there be any other changes?
Ashad/Cybermen
What’s this? A Dalek and Cybermen story? Even though the villains have appeared together briefly in numerous other stories, the Centenary Special boasts ‘Army of Ghosts/Doomsday’ levels of appearances from the timelord’s biggest foes. What’s worse for the Doctor, this time they’ve got Ashad (Patrick O’Kane) – the ruthless incomplete Cyberman who first appeared in ‘The Haunting of Villa Diodati’.
The last time we saw the Cybermen they were seemingly blown up, along with the Master on Gallifrey, and Ashad had been shrunk! How did they escape, and what do they have planned now?
The Master
My personal favourite incarnation returns! The Master (Sacha Dhawan) has finally been confirmed! Possibly the most rumoured character to return in the Doctor Who centenary special, it’s good to know he’s back. Telling the Doctor ‘this is the day you die’ in the trailer, and glimpses of him looking, well, a tad worse-for-wear, some fans believe he’s after the Doctor’s regenerations. Whatever he’s up to, it’s no wonder the Doctor is regenerating facing THREE villains all at once.
